정렬 알고리즘 시간복잡도

2019. 3. 28. 20:44알고리즘/정렬

정렬 알고리즘 시간복잡도 비교

 

 



단순(구현 간단)하지만 비효율적인 방법
   삽입 정렬, 선택 정렬, 버블 정렬

 

복잡하지만 효율적인 방법
  퀵 정렬, 힙 정렬, 합병 정렬, 기수 정렬

 

 

선형 시간 알고리즘

 

명칭                                                                       실행시간                           실행시간 예

linear time(선형시간)   O(n) n

'알고리즘 > 정렬' 카테고리의 다른 글

평균 선형 시간 선택 알고리즘  (0) 2019.03.28
힙 정렬(Heap Sort)  (0) 2019.03.28
퀵 정렬(Quick Sort)  (0) 2019.03.28
병합정렬(merge sort)  (0) 2019.03.28
삽입 정렬(insertion sort)  (0) 2019.03.28